New Features in Sourcery VSIPL++ 1.1
Some of the highlights of Sourcery VSIPL++ 1.1 include:
-
Sourcery VSIPL++ 1.1 adds support for the Mercury PowerPC MCOE operating system. Sourcery VSIPL++ automatically makes use of Mercury's high-performance Scientific Algorithm Library (SAL) for mathematical computation and Verari's MPI/Pro library for parallel communication. Sourcery VSIPL++ 1.1 also adds support for Sun's Solaris operating system. You can use Sourcery VSIPL++ 1.1 to develop GNU/Linux, Solaris, or MCOE applications.
-
Sourcery VSIPL++ includes numerous performance improvements, including automatic use of SIMD instructions for commonly used computations and better FFT performance.
-
Sourcery VSIPL++ 1.1 implements the parallel API specification approved by the VSIPL Forum.
